77% dropoff for Grand Theft Auto? Wow, that's more than I expected too. To me, the rate at which GTA sales hold up is by far the most interesting question in the market right now. I know I'm not the only one who theorized that the latest GTA game would see weaker staying power than its predecessors, due to install base/cost issues. Now, it's WAY too early to draw any conclusions from this, but I find it interesting nonetheless.

Another sign of a front-loaded game is a large increase in hardware sales on the week of release. Generally speaking, the bigger the spike in hardware, the more front-loaded the sales of the software tend to be. (The ultimate example of this is the sales of Final Fantasy games in Japan, which often spike hardware by 100% on release week - and also do 2/3 of lifetime sales in week #1!) The latest Grand Theft Auto might fall into this category, albeit to a lesser extent - time will tell.

It's also noteworthy that Halo 3's sales fell by 83% worldwide in week #2 (and Halo is usually referenced as a classic case of a heavily hyped, highly front-loaded game).

@Source: Ioi actually said that games in UK are more front-loaded than in other part of Europe/Others, so we can expect smaller than 77% drop in Europe. NA games tends to drop harder but it may not be the case this week. I think that good second week fore games in EU compared to NA is partialy based on the fact that most games in EU have less days to sell in their first week; but this was not the case for GTA4.

GTA4 still beats Halo 3 which dropped 79% after first week in UK with one day less to sell in first week.
